Overview

In this book we are trying to illuminate the persistent and nag­ ging questions of how mind, life, and the essence of being relate to brain mechanisms. We do that not because we have a commit­ ment to bear witness to the boring issue of reductionism but because we want to know more about what it's all about. How, in­ deed, does the brain work? How does it allow us to love, hate, see, cry, suffer, and ultimately understand Kepler's laws? We try to uncover clues to these staggering questions by con­ sidering the results of our studies on the bisected brain. Several years back, one of us wrote a book with that title, and the approach was to describe how brain and behavior are affected when one takes the brain apart. In the present book, we are ready to put it back together, and go beyond, for we feel that split-brain studies are now at the point of contributing to an understanding of the workings of the integrated mind. Table of Contents

1— The Split Brain and the Integrated Mind.- 2— The Nature of Interhemispheric Communication.- 3— Cerebral Lateralization and Hemisphere Specialization: Facts and Theory.- 4— Brain and Language.- 5— Brain and Intelligence.- 6— Brain, Imagery, and Memory.- 7— On the Mechanisms of Mind.- Author Index.
